Transaction 50423d604215a24fa2cbf68bfcdfb8d913f896296463e00dc98b292b129bad98
1 Input
1 Output
-
50423d604215a24fa2cbf68bfcdfb8d913f896296463e00dc98b292b129bad98:0
- value
- 303699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c134aba4ed4395fb5c6938f30bbc322d3fadf54e OP_EQUAL
- address
- 3KJbSBC1Ww5Ppb2Xaz9VyrhwiWqrdAK9Jm